优化你的Redis集群配置吧(redis集群配置优化)
Redis是一种高性能的内存数据库,它可以在计算机上加快各种工作流的执行速度,这对现代的企业来说是非常重要的。但是,Redis可能不会自动为用户提供一个最佳的集群配置,所以,本文介绍Redis集群配置如何优化。
我们必须关注Redis故障转移情况。可以使用Redis Sentinel函数来监测服务器可用性,并在遇到故障时自动转移服务到较新的服务器上。这样,用户只需配置一次故障转移,在所有Redis节点重新进行适当的配置后,就能够保证Redis服务可用性。另外,我们也可以使用Redis Cluster功能,提高Redis原子性操作的安全性。
可以进行服务器硬件配置优化,以便Redis能够获得最佳性能和稳定性。服务器应搭载大内存、更快的存储设备和更快的CPU,以减少存储设备和CPU的I/O瓶颈,其中,内存大小应根据实际工作量来定。此外,Redis访问地址也应被正确配置,以便可以根据负载均衡的策略灵活地进行访问控制。
在Redis客户端可以采用更复杂的配置,使得Redis更加健壮。比如,可以配置客户端的连接参数,包括设置最大连接数和最大空闲连接数,该参数将决定客户端可以连接Redis集群的最大数量,这些参数可以帮助服务器设置更合理的负载以获得更高的性能。此外,客户端还应该开启Redis ACL功能,以控制哪些用户可以连接Redis,以及写入和读取Redis数据。
优化Redis集群配置是一项重要的工作,可以有效提高Redis的性能、稳定性和可用性,从而为企业带来巨大的经济效益。